Lines of trucks formed on the border of Poland with Ukraine and Belarus.

Huge queues of trucks have accumulated on the Polish border with Ukraine and Belarus, Michal Derus, a representative of the Lublin tax chamber, told reporters.

“On Saturday, about a thousand trucks stand in Dorohusk to leave Poland for Ukraine, which means 45 hours of waiting,” he said.

According to the tax representative, there is no queue of trucks on the Ukrainian side.

At the same time, during the last night shift at the border crossing in Dorohusk, 640 trucks were issued in both directions.


About 400 trucks are waiting to leave for Ukraine through the border crossing in Khrebennoye – the queue is 25 hours. On the Ukrainian side, there are 60 cars here, that is, six hours of waiting to enter Poland. During the last shift, a total of 242 trucks were registered at this crossing.


According to the tax chamber, on Saturday, about 900 trucks are waiting to leave Poland at the Koroschin border crossing on the border with Belarus, and the waiting time in line is about 30 hours. It is noted that there is no queue in the opposite direction. During the night shift, 639 trucks were registered in both directions at this only active freight crossing with Belarus.
